Transaction e41bbda4fe21b99e9b2c5025b22383bfff3485a759adeea7b3cd1ae76f5d3259

1 Input
2 Outputs
  • e41bbda4fe21b99e9b2c5025b22383bfff3485a759adeea7b3cd1ae76f5d3259:0
  • value  346366309
    address  1abzXp3zRGwqUUktvswGGHDYQW2KjeuYn
  • e41bbda4fe21b99e9b2c5025b22383bfff3485a759adeea7b3cd1ae76f5d3259:1
  • value  653277891
    address  1qKRFB16NZXjhpaY5gJK6sFWcEYJu4bed